DHL WP U19 finish runners-up

PUBLISHED: October 22, 2016


DHL Western Province U19 finished the SA Rugby U19 Championship as runners-up after going down 60-19 to the Xerox Golden Lions U19 in the final in Bloemfontein on Saturday.

Having won 11 of their 13 games on their way to the final, it was a disapointing outing for a DHL Western Province U19 team which dominated the league phase of the competition to finish top of the log.

The Johannesburg team grabbed the early advantage as a penalty from flyhalf Jean-Luc Cilliers was followed up by a try against the run of play from left wing Stean Pienaar after they had absorbed some considerable pressure from DHL Western Province U19.

They extended their lead with aother penalty shortly afterwards, after DHL Western Province U19 strayed offside, with another try against the run of play putting them 20-0 up after just 22 minutes.

They were not done there, as right wing Tyreeq February dotted down for their third try to take their lead out to 27-0, leaving DHL Western Province U19 with it all to do.

They responded with a try from captain Ernst van Rhyn, who crashed over following an attacking line-out to get his team on the scoreboard.

However, the Xerox Golden Lions U19 hit back with a fourth try just before half-time, to give them a 34-7 advantage at the break.

DHL Western Province U19 were first to strike in the second half as big No.8 Juarno Augustus forced his way over for a try, but the Xerox Golden Lions U19 hit back with their fifth try to make it 41-14 with 30 minutes left to play.

As they searched for a comeback, DHL Western Province were forced to take some extra risks, which allowed their opponents to score a further three tries before DHL Western Province U19 managed to score a late consolation try through outside centre David Brits.

The scorers:

For DHL Western Province U19:
Tries: Van Rhyn, Augustus, Brits
Cons: Williams 2

For Xerox Golden Lions U19:
Tries: Pienaar, Vermaak, February, Jansen, Dayimani 2, Tambwe 2
Cons: Cilliers 7
Pens: Cilliers 2
